Chris Hayes is Known for

Chris Hayes is an American journalist, author, and television host who built his career through political reporting and nightly commentary. Many people recognize him from All In with Chris Hayes on MSNBC, where he covers national policy, elections, and social issues. As you look at his work, you’ll notice his focus on data, interviews, and progressive viewpoints. He also writes books and hosts a popular podcast, which helps expand his discussions beyond cable news.

Notable Controversies

(2024) Hayes publicly apologized after using a video in a segment on social-media political ads that he had not credited. Critics accused him of journalistic sloppiness and undermining trust in media attribution.

(2019) He sharply criticized his own network’s leadership for allegedly suppressing Ronan Farrow’s reporting on Harvey Weinstein. The charge of internal cover-ups sparked intense debate within media circles about network accountability.

(2016–Present) Hayes and his show are regularly criticized for strong left-leaning media bias and mixed reliability. Independent media-bias assessments label his program as hyper-partisan with problematic reliability.
